Wrexham: A Comprehensive Guide to the Welsh Town and Its Football Club
Wrexham, a historic town located in North Wales, has been drawing increased attention in recent years, especially due to the…
Wrexham, a historic town located in North Wales, has been drawing increased attention in recent years, especially due to the…
Luton Town is a town with a rich history and a dynamic present, located in the county of Bedfordshire, England.…